vimiReview
Build a QR-code-friendly star rating form and feed the scores directly into each employee's monthly performance.
What is it?โ
vimiReview is how customers, colleagues, or managers rate someone on a 1โ5 star scale. You build a form with the attributes you want rated ("Politeness", "Speed", "Product Knowledge"), decide who gets reviewed, and share the public link or QR code. Every submission is stored, tagged by month, and - if you want - automatically converted into a performance percentage in vimiClass.
Three common patterns cover most use cases:
- Customer โ Staff - a cafรฉ's QR code at each table, a retail receipt that invites a rating, a service provider who texts a link after a job. Customers rate the specific staff who served them.
- Internal peer review - a monthly or quarterly round where colleagues rate each other, usually for HR analytics rather than payout.
- Branch feedback - a general rating for a location with no staff selection. Works for walk-in clinics, showrooms, waiting rooms.
Run a review cycle every month, a quarter, or keep a CSAT form running permanently and let the month-tagging do the grouping. Use vimiReview alongside vimiGoal when customer score is part of the monthly KPI, or alongside vimiTeam when service quality should influence team rewards.

For Admins (Employer / HR / Manager)โ
How to create a customer feedback formโ
Use this pattern when you want customers to rate a specific staff member and have the score flow into that person's monthly performance.
- Go to vimiReview โ Manage and click "Create New Review".
- In "Review Name", type an internal name - e.g.
Customer Satisfaction Score (CSAT). This isn't shown to customers. - In "Title Header", type what customers see - e.g.
Rate My Service!. - Add a "Description" line.
- Under "Options":
- Tick "Track Responses" - stops the same phone number submitting twice.
- Tick "Staff Review" - a new "Staff to Review" section appears.
- Tick "Include in vimiClass Performance" - this is the key setting that ties ratings into each staff member's monthly performance.
- Under "Staff to Review", click the "All Staff" chip (or a specific department like "Sales") to add reviewees.
- Under "Attribute Name", add the things you want rated -
Politeness,Product Knowledge,Speed. Click the (+) after each one. Tick "Remark?" next to any attribute where you want a written comment alongside the star rating. - Optionally pick a "Background Color" to match your brand - there are 19 presets or a full colour picker.
- Click "Save and Return to Configure vimiReview".
- From the form's detail page, click "Copy Link" to get the public URL, or "Send via WhatsApp" to share it with staff to forward to customers.
Tip: Each time a customer rates a staff member on this form, the employee's vimiClass performance percentage updates within seconds. Formula: average star rating รท 5 ร 100. So a 4.5-star average becomes a 90% performance score for that month.
How to create a branch feedback formโ
Use this when no specific staff member is involved - a lobby rating, a general shop experience.
- Create a new review.
- Leave "Staff Review" unticked.
- Tick "Anonymous Review" so the name and phone number fields become optional - helps response rates.
- Leave "Track Responses" unticked so repeat visitors can submit every time.
- Tick "Feedback" to add an open-text box at the end.
- Add your attributes - e.g.
Cleanliness,Staff Helpfulness,Value for Money. - Save and publish. Share the link as a QR code.

How to save and use a templateโ
If HR runs the same review every month, save the attributes once and re-use.
- Open a form with the right attributes.
- Click "Save As Template".
- A dialog asks for "Enter a Template Name" - e.g.
Monthly Performance Matrix. - Click "confirm". The template saves under vimiReview โ Templates.
To apply a template:
- Create a new review.
- Before adding attributes, click "Apply Template".
- Pick your template and click "Apply Template".
- A confirmation appears: "Applying templates will overwrite all current attributes. Are you sure you want to continue?" - click continue.
How to control who sees responses on mobileโ
By default, staff see only their own responses. Managers see only their own. HR sees only their own. The employer sees everything. Three toggles change that.
- Open the staff review form in edit mode.
- Scroll to "Mobile Response Visibility" (under Staff Review settings). Note: this is staging-only.
- Decide:
- "Staff can see all feedback responses in their department on mobile" - on if you want transparent team culture, off if privacy matters.
- "Managers can see all feedback responses in their department on mobile" - on for managers who coach their team on mobile.
- "HR/Admin can see all feedback responses on mobile" - on for HR who review performance in the field.
- Save.
The typical setup: managers ON, staff OFF. Managers can coach with data; staff still have privacy.
How to run a monthly review cycleโ
vimiReview doesn't have a built-in "cycle" with automatic open/close dates. You run it manually:
- Create and publish the form at the start of the month.
- Share the QR code / link.
- At month-end, edit the form and change "Status" from "Published" to "Disabled". The public link now shows a closed message.
- Open the form by clicking its name to see all responses. Click the "Staff Ratings" tab for each reviewee's aggregate.
- Next month: click the "..." menu on the original form and pick "Copy" to duplicate. The copy resets the edit count. Publish the copy.
For staff review forms, responses are auto-tagged by month, so one running form still gives you month-by-month history on the "Monthly Staff Reviews" tab.
How to handle the 5-edit limitโ
Every published form can only be edited five times to protect data integrity of existing responses.
- If "This form has reached its edit limit (5/5)" appears and the Edit button is grey, click the "..." menu on the form list and select "Copy".
- The copy has a fresh edit count. Make changes and publish it.
- Go back to the original and set its status to "Disabled" so old QR codes show the closed message.
- Distribute the new form's URL.
Warning: Copying a form strips all SRA Watchers/Editors. After creating the copy, go into its SRA section and re-assign them.
For Employeesโ
How to view your own feedbackโ
- Open the vimigo mobile app.
- Go to "vimiReview" in the menu.
- Tap the review form where you're a reviewee.
- The "Reviewee Summary" section at the top shows your average rating and response count for the month.
- Scroll to see individual response cards with each reviewer's rating and any remarks.
- Use the month/year filter at the top to switch between months.
If the form doesn't appear, ask your admin to check that you're in the form's reviewee list.
What you won't seeโ
Unless your admin enables the mobile visibility toggles, you only see responses about yourself - not your colleagues' ratings. If the form has "Anonymous Review" enabled, the reviewer names are hidden too.
For Reviewers (customers, peers)โ
If you're the person submitting a rating, the flow is:
- Scan the QR code or open the link.
- If the form has staff selection, pick the employee who served you from the dropdown.
- Pick the "Review for" month (it defaults to the current month).
- Use the star sliders to rate each attribute from 1 to 5.
- If there's a "Feedback" text box, add any comments.
- If an attribute has a "Remark?" field, type your reason for that specific rating.
- Optionally attach up to 5 files (photos, documents).
- Click "Submit".
If you close the form without submitting, your phone number is remembered for 48 hours - you can come back and finish.
Settings & Configurationโ
| Setting | What it does | Default | Where |
|---|---|---|---|
| "Review Name" | Internal-only name | - | Create/edit form |
| "Title Header" | Public-facing title at the top of the form | - | Create/edit form |
| "Description" | Public-facing subtitle | - | Create/edit form |
| "Background Color" | Header background on the public form (19 presets + colour picker) | #F5FAFF | Create/edit form |
| "Feedback" | Adds an open-text box at the end of the form | Off | Options section |
| "Anonymous Review" | Makes the reviewer's name and phone fields optional | Off | Options section |
| "Track Responses" | Limits a phone number to one submission | Off | Options section |
| "Staff Review" | Adds a staff dropdown and month picker; required for vimiClass integration | Off | Options section |
| "Staff to Review" | Which employees appear in the reviewee dropdown | - | Staff Review subsection |
| "Include in vimiClass Performance" | Sends the score into vimiClass on each submission | Off | Staff Review subsection |
| "Remark?" | Per-attribute - forces a written comment alongside the stars | Off | Attributes section |
| "Upload Logo" | Shows your company logo at the top of the public form | Off | Create/edit form |
| "vimiReview Image" | Adds a banner image below the title | Off | Create/edit form |
| "Notified People" | Users who receive a push notification on every new submission | Empty | Create/edit form |
| "Status" | Draft (link inactive), Published (live), or Disabled (shows closed message) | Draft | List view |
Rating scaleโ
vimiReview uses a 1โ5 star scale on every attribute. There is no Yes/No, numeric, or text-only scale.
Overall rating = sum of all attribute ratings รท number of attributes.
Example: 3 attributes rated 5, 4, 3 โ overall = (5 + 4 + 3) / 3 = 4.0
vimiClass performance % = (overall / 5) ร 100
So 4.0 stars = 80% performance score.
Who sees what on mobile (default)โ
| Role | Sees |
|---|---|
| Employer | All responses, always |
| HR / Admin | All company responses, always |
| Manager | Only their own responses (if they are a reviewee) |
| Staff (reviewee) | Only their own responses |
| Staff (non-reviewee) | Nothing |
Turn on the mobile visibility toggles to broaden what managers, HR, and staff see. The employer always has full visibility regardless.
FAQโ
Q: The Submit button does nothing when a customer tries to submit.
A: A mandatory field is blank. The browser shows a red "This field is required" above the missing field. Most common causes: an unfilled star rating, an unticked "Agree to Privacy Notice" checkbox, or a required "Remark?" field left empty.
Q: The form shows "Feature Locked!" when someone submits.
A: Your company has hit its subscription plan's response limit. Your account manager needs to upgrade the plan.
Q: I updated the logo but the old one is still showing.
A: Logos cache for up to 45 minutes. Wait it out, or ask vimigo support to flush the cache for that form.
Q: The Edit button is grey.
A: Either the form has hit the 5-edit limit (copy it and edit the copy), or your account doesn't have SRA Editor access for this form (ask the form owner to add you).
Q: I duplicated a form and now other managers can't see it.
A: Copying strips all SRA roles. Open the new form's SRA section and reassign Watchers and Editors.
Q: A staff member says they can't see their review responses on mobile.
A: Check three things. The staff member's user ID must be in the form's reviewee list. The form must be Published. And on staging, if all three mobile visibility toggles are off, staff only see their own - which means there must be at least one submitted response for them.
Q: Do the scores really update vimiClass in real time?
A: Yes. Every submission triggers a recalculation of that reviewee's monthly average. If a customer submits a 5-star rating, you'll see the staff member's vimiClass performance tick up within seconds.
Q: If a customer submits five 5-star ratings for the same person in one month, does vimiClass update each time?
A: Yes, if "Track Responses" is off, each submission recalculates the average. If it's on, the same phone number only counts once (their previous submission is overwritten).
Q: Where does the public review URL come from?
A: It's auto-generated when you first save the form. It appears in the form's "Copy Link" and "Send via WhatsApp" buttons.
Q: What's the difference between the three form statuses?
A: Draft - the form is being built; the public link does nothing. Published - live; anyone with the link can submit. Disabled - closed; the link shows a "closed" message to visitors.
Q: Can I compare ratings year over year?
A: On the admin panel, use the date filter on the responses page to compare periods. There's no built-in annual comparison chart, but you can export monthly data to Excel and build it there.
